James Stewart: Early Life and Rise to Fame
James Stewart American actor, also known as James Maitland Stewart, was born in Indiana, Pennsylvania, and grew up in a small-town environment that shaped his grounded personality. Before becoming a film actor, he studied architecture at Princeton University, but his passion for performing arts eventually led him toward acting.
His early Hollywood career began in the 1930s, where he quickly gained attention for his natural acting style. Unlike many actors of his era, James Stewart film actor reputation was built on authenticity rather than theatrical performance. This made him stand out in the Golden Age of Hollywood.
His breakthrough came with films like Mr. Smith Goes to Washington and The Philadelphia Story, which established him as a leading actor. His performances reflected honesty, emotional depth, and relatability, making him one of the most admired figures in American cinema.

Military Service and James Stewart Pilot Career
One of the most remarkable aspects of James Stewart’s life was his military service. Known as James Stewart pilot during World War II, he served in the United States Army Air Forces as a bomber pilot. His service added a heroic dimension to his public image.
After the war, he continued his association with the military and later became a Brigadier General in the U.S. Air Force Reserve. This rare combination of Hollywood fame and military achievement made him unique among actors of his generation.
His wartime experience deeply influenced his personality and acting style, bringing more emotional realism to his later film roles.

James Stewart Death and Legacy
James Stewart death occurred on July 2, 1997, marking the end of an era in Hollywood history. His cause of death was related to natural age-related health complications. The news of his passing was widely covered across global media, and tributes came from actors, filmmakers, and fans around the world.
His legacy, however, continues to live on through his films, military service, and cultural influence. He remains one of the most respected figures in American cinema history.
